First-time Internet users find boost in brain function after just 1 week

Monday, October 19, 2009 - 17:14 in Psychology & Sociology

You can teach an old dog new tricks, say UCLA scientists who found that middle-aged and older adults with little Internet experience were able to trigger key centers in the brain that control decision-making and complex reasoning after just one week of surfing the Web.
